How to Enroll In the Right LPN Program near Elmsford New York<\/h2>\n

\"ElmsfordThere are generally two academic credentials available that provide education to become an LPN near Elmsford NY<\/strong>. The one that may be completed in the shortest time period, usually about 12 months, is the certificate or diploma program. The other option is to attain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are more comprehensive in nature than the diploma option and typically require 2 years to finish. The advantage of Associate Degrees, in addition to offering a higher credential and more comprehensive training,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. No matter the kind of credential you seek, it should be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or some other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C warrants that the syllabus effectively pr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that the majority of gra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.<\/p>\n

What is an LPN?<\/h3>\n

\"ElmsfordLicensed Practical Nurses have a number of duties that they complete in the Elmsford NY healthcare facilities where they practice. As their titles imply, they are required to be licensed in all states, including New York. While they may be accountable for monitoring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ves typically work under the direction of either an RN or a doctor. The healthcare facilities where they work are numerous and varied, for instance h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Virtually any place that you can find patients seeking medical attention is their domain. Each state not only regulates their licensing, but also what work activities an LPN can and can’t perform.
